I think removing the reward completely would dramatically cut Frontlines participation, and since you need 72 players to start a game, things could be very bad if the population takes even a modest hit. Even post-6.1, though, tons of players finish a full-length game with under 100k damage, which is trivial to achieve if you deliberately fight anyone ever. Rewards should feel attainable, but there needs to be more than just an attendance check.

I think Guild Wars 2 gets very close to balancing this correctly. You get 3 points for a loss and 10 points for a win, which feels like roughly the right ratio, but you get a bonus 2 points if the loss is super close, and a single bonus point if you're top of the scoreboard in any category.
